plyometrics

English dictionary entry

Meanings

noun
  1. A form of exercise that involves the rapid stretching and contracting of muscles to develop muscular power.

Word forms

plyometrics

Etymology

From Ancient Greek πλείων (pleíōn, “more”) + -metric (“measure”). Additional details are available in Wikipedia at plyometrics § Etymology.
